Output 68b5625a5d71369e144c3927995b4b335ceece0fc798438df5ed0cff56fe7f6a:0

value
588468
script pubkey
OP_0 OP_PUSHBYTES_20 bf12836a36ed50c73baa04c46108008ae3f5aafe
address
bc1qhufgx63ka4gvwwa2qnzxzzqq3t3lt2h7esxe2g
transaction
68b5625a5d71369e144c3927995b4b335ceece0fc798438df5ed0cff56fe7f6a
spent
true